YY软件园-为您提供一个绿色下载空间!
当前位置: 首页 > 资讯 > 区块链

python发送whatsapp消息,轻松发送WhatsApp消息的代码实践指南

来源:小编 更新:2025-01-25 11:55:46

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,用Python给远在地球另一端的好友发送一条温馨的问候,或者是在关键时刻提醒自己一个重要的约会?现在,这不再是梦想啦!今天,就让我带你一起探索如何用Python发送WhatsApp消息,让你的沟通变得更加智能和便捷!

一、Python与WhatsApp的奇妙邂逅

Python,这个在编程界享有盛誉的语言,凭借其简洁的语法和强大的功能,成为了无数开发者的心头好。而WhatsApp,作为全球最受欢迎的即时通讯工具,拥有超过20亿的活跃用户。当Python遇见WhatsApp,会发生怎样的化学反应呢?

其实,这一切都要归功于一个叫做“Twilio”的云通讯平台。Twilio提供了丰富的API接口,让开发者能够轻松地将自己的应用程序与WhatsApp等通讯工具连接起来。而Python,作为Twilio官方支持的编程语言,自然成为了实现这一功能的最佳选择。

二、搭建Python发送WhatsApp消息的舞台

想要用Python发送WhatsApp消息,首先你得准备好以下“道具”:

1. Python环境:确保你的电脑上已经安装了Python,版本最好是3.6及以上。

2. Twilio账户:注册Twilio官网,获取一个免费的账户,并获取你的API密钥。

3. 手机:一部装有WhatsApp的手机,用于接收验证码。

4. 第三方库:安装Twilio的Python库,可以使用pip命令进行安装:

```

pip install twilio

```

一切准备就绪后,就可以开始编写代码啦!

三、编写Python发送WhatsApp消息的脚本

以下是一个简单的Python脚本示例,演示如何使用Twilio发送WhatsApp消息:

```python

from twilio.rest import Client

你的Twilio账号SID和认证令牌

account_sid = '你的账号SID'

auth_token = '你的认证令牌'

创建Twilio客户端

client = Client(account_sid, auth_token)

要发送的消息内容

message = 'Hello, this is a test message from Python!'

要发送给的手机号码

to_number = '接收者的WhatsApp手机号码'

发送消息

client.messages.create(

body=message,

from_='whatsapp:+14155238886', Twilio提供的WhatsApp电话号码

to=to_number

运行这段代码,你就可以看到一条来自Python的消息出现在你的WhatsApp聊天中啦!

四、定制你的WhatsApp消息

当然,发送一条简单的“Hello”已经不能满足你的需求了。接下来,让我们一起探索如何定制你的WhatsApp消息。

1. 添加附件:你可以发送图片、视频、音频等多种类型的附件。只需在`client.messages.create`方法中添加相应的参数即可。

2. 群发消息:Twilio提供了群发功能,你可以一次性发送消息给多个联系人。只需在`to`参数中传入多个手机号码,用逗号分隔即可。

3. 定时发送:Twilio还支持定时发送消息。只需在`client.messages.create`方法中添加`date`参数,指定发送时间即可。

4. 个性化消息:你可以根据不同的联系人发送不同的消息。只需在脚本中添加相应的逻辑判断即可。

五、

通过Python发送WhatsApp消息,让你的沟通变得更加智能和便捷。无论是发送一条简单的问候,还是实现复杂的自动化任务,Python都能帮你轻松搞定。快来尝试一下吧,让你的生活变得更加丰富多彩!


玩家评论

此处添加你的第三方评论代码
Copyright © 2012-2024 YY软件园 版权所有 Powered by EyouCms